11ea09effc [CUDACachingAlloc/GPUInference] Implement garbage collection without GPU sync (#74261)
Summary:
Pull Request resolved: https://github.com/pytorch/pytorch/pull/74261

### Goal
Implement a cheap way to reclaim GPU memory (garbage collection) without incurring GPU sync.

### Why do we need this?
Currently, there are only two ways to reclaim GPU memory block already assigned to a particular stream.

- `release_available_cached_blocks(params)`: Free blocks exceeding the `CachingAllocatorConfig::max_split_size()` until we can satisfy the request.

Issue: If the `max_split_size` is unset (default), this function is a no-op. Even if this is set, the reclamation is quite conservative (e.g., never frees blocks under max_split_size).

- `release_cached_blocks()`: Waits for all the in-flight events and then reclaim blocks.

Issue: 'waiting for all event' is very expensive as it will likely stall all the GPU operations. Many GPU applications without a proper handling of potential GPU throttling would suffer/crash.

### Proposed idea
- If the garbage collection threshold is set, try to reclaim some memory blocks *without* synchronization. It should be safe to do so, as `release_available_cached_blocks` essentially does the same thing (but less aggressively).
- GC is triggered only when we fail to serve a `malloc` request from the block pool. No need to free blocks when the block pool is functioning just fine.
- Prioritize reclaiming blocks that weren't reused for long time. Reclamation stops once the used memory capacity < threshold.
- This code path is totally optional; by default it won't be invoked.

ac3effd150 [PyTorch GPU Allocator] Better use of blocks with rounding of allocation sizes (#74213)
Summary:
Pull Request resolved: https://github.com/pytorch/pytorch/pull/74213

In the current CUDACachingAllocator, the sizes are rounded up in multiple of blocks size of 512, so this works for smaller sizes. However for large sizes, we can have lots of different size blocks in the larger pool. This is problematic when we have variable batch sizes 1001, 1021, 1023 -> all will go to different block size and will create different size of blocks. This will create lots of unused blocks and will waste GPU memory capacity.

This diff adds a rounding approach to allocation size. It rounds up the size to nearest power-of-2 divisions and the power2-division can be changed with env variable setting.

   For example, if we need to round-up  size of1200 and if number of divisions is 4,
   the size 1200 lies between 1024 and 2048 and if we do 4 divisions between
   them, the values are 1024, 1280, 1536, and 1792. So the function will
   return 1280 as the nearest ceiling of power-2 division.

env setting:
   export PYTORCH_CUDA_ALLOC_CONF=roundup_power2_divisions:4

675cea1adb [CUDA graphs][BC-breaking] Removes post-backward syncs on default stream (#60421)
Summary:
Before https://github.com/pytorch/pytorch/pull/57833, calls to backward() or grad() synced only the calling thread's default stream with autograd leaf streams at the end of backward. This made the following weird pattern safe:
```python
with torch.cuda.stream(s):
    # imagine forward used many streams, so backward leaf nodes may run on many streams
    loss.backward()
# no sync
use grads
```

but a more benign-looking pattern was unsafe:
```python
with torch.cuda.stream(s):
    # imagine forward used a lot of streams, so backward leaf nodes may run on many streams
    loss.backward()
    # backward() syncs the default stream with all the leaf streams, but does not sync s with anything,
    # so counterintuitively (even though we're in the same stream context as backward()!)
    # it is NOT SAFE to use grads here, and there's no easy way to make it safe,
    # unless you manually sync on all the streams you used in forward,
    # or move "use grads" back to default stream outside the context.
    use grads
```
mruberry ngimel and I decided backward() should have the [same user-facing stream semantics as any cuda op](https://pytorch.org/docs/master/notes/cuda.html#stream-semantics-of-backward-passes).** In other words, the weird pattern should be unsafe, and the benign-looking pattern should be safe. Implementationwise, this meant backward() should sync its calling thread's current stream, not default stream, with the leaf streams.

After https://github.com/pytorch/pytorch/pull/57833, backward syncs the calling thread's current stream AND default stream with all leaf streams at the end of backward. The default stream syncs were retained for temporary backward compatibility.

This PR finishes https://github.com/pytorch/pytorch/pull/57833's work by deleting syncs on the default stream.

With this PR, graph-capturing an entire backward() call should be possible (see the [test_graph_grad_scaling diffs](https://github.com/pytorch/pytorch/compare/master...mcarilli:streaming_backwards_remove_default_syncs?expand=1#diff-893b1eea27352f336f4cd832919e48d721e4e90186e63400b8596db6b82e7450R3641-R3642)).

** first paragraph has a formatting error which this PR should also fix.

2f3be2735f Don't split oversize cached blocks (#44742)
Summary:
Fixes https://github.com/pytorch/pytorch/issues/35901

This change is designed to prevent fragmentation in the Caching Allocator.  Permissive block splitting in the allocator allows very large blocks to be split into many pieces.  Once split too finely it is unlikely all pieces will be 'free' at that same time so the original allocation can never be returned.   Anecdotally, we've seen a model run out of memory failing to alloc a 50 MB block on a 32 GB card while the caching allocator is holding 13 GB of 'split free blocks'

Approach:

- Large blocks above a certain size are designated "oversize".  This limit is currently set 1 decade above large, 200 MB
- Oversize blocks can not be split
- Oversize blocks must closely match the requested size (e.g. a 200 MB request will match an existing 205 MB block, but not a 300 MB block)
- In lieu of splitting oversize blocks there is a mechanism to quickly free a single oversize block (to the system allocator) to allow an appropriate size block to be allocated.  This will be activated under memory pressure and will prevent _release_cached_blocks()_ from triggering

Initial performance tests show this is similar or quicker than the original strategy.  Additional tests are ongoing.

5640b79bf8 Allow consumer ops to sync on GraphRoot's gradient (#45787)
Summary:
Currently, a GraphRoot instance doesn't have an associated stream.  Streaming backward synchronization logic assumes the instance ran on the default stream, and tells consumer ops to sync with the default stream.  If the gradient the GraphRoot instance passes to consumer backward ops was populated on a non-default stream, we have a race condition.

The race condition can exist even if the user doesn't give a manually populated gradient:
```python
with torch.cuda.stream(side_stream):
    # loss.backward() implicitly synthesizes a one-element 1.0 tensor on side_stream
    # GraphRoot passes it to consumers, but consumers first sync on default stream, not side_stream.
    loss.backward()

    # Internally to backward(), streaming-backward logic takes over, stuff executes on the same stream it ran on in forward,
    # and the side_stream context is irrelevant.  GraphRoot's interaction with its first consumer(s) is the spot where
    # the side_stream context causes a problem.
```

This PR fixes the race condition by associating a GraphRoot instance, at construction time, with the current stream(s) on the device(s) of the grads it will pass to consumers. (i think this relies on GraphRoot executing in the main thread, before backward thread(s) fork, because the grads were populated on the main thread.)

The test demonstrates the race condition. It fails reliably without the PR's GraphRoot diffs and passes with the GraphRoot diffs.

With the GraphRoot diffs, manually populating an incoming-gradient arg for `backward` (or `torch.autograd.grad`) and the actual call to `autograd.backward` will have the same stream-semantics relationship as any other pair of ops:
```python
# implicit population is safe
with torch.cuda.stream(side_stream):
    loss.backward()

# explicit population in side stream then backward in side stream is safe
with torch.cuda.stream(side_stream):
    kickoff_grad = torch.ones_like(loss)
    loss.backward(gradient=kickoff_grad)

# explicit population in one stream then backward kickoff in another stream
# is NOT safe, even with this PR's diffs, but that unsafety is consistent with
# stream-semantics relationship of any pair of ops
kickoff_grad = torch.ones_like(loss)
with torch.cuda.stream(side_stream):
    loss.backward(gradient=kickoff_grad)

# Safe, as you'd expect for any pair of ops
kickoff_grad = torch.ones_like(loss)
side_stream.wait_stream(torch.cuda.current_stream())
with torch.cuda.stream(side_stream):
    loss.backward(gradient=kickoff_grad)
```
This PR also adds the last three examples above to cuda docs and references them from autograd docstrings.

03342af3a3 Add env variable to bypass CUDACachingAllocator for debugging (#45294)
Summary:
Pull Request resolved: https://github.com/pytorch/pytorch/pull/45294

While tracking down a recent memory corruption bug we found that
cuda-memcheck wasn't finding the bad accesses, and ngimel pointed out that
it's because we use a caching allocator so a lot of "out of bounds" accesses
land in a valid slab.

This PR adds a runtime knob (`PYTORCH_NO_CUDA_MEMORY_CACHING`) that, when set,
bypasses the caching allocator's caching logic so that allocations go straight
to cudaMalloc.  This way, cuda-memcheck will actually work.
